Pros & Cons
Exercise.com
Pros
- Custom-branded iOS and Android apps with your name in the App Store
- Hybrid model supports online coaching and in-person training from one platform
- Massive exercise library with video demonstrations saves content creation time
- E-commerce built in for selling programs, challenges, and digital products
- Workout delivery to remote clients enables revenue beyond your four walls
Cons
- Expensive at $249-$499/month for full features — overkill for basic group fitness
- Custom app development adds setup time and cost
- Gym management features trail Mindbody and Glofox in depth
- Fewer direct integrations with third-party fitness tools
- Learning curve for workout builder and program creation is steep initially
Glofox
Pros
- Branded member app looks premium — members think it was custom-built for your studio
- Dashboard is fast and intuitive — staff learn the system in 2-3 days
- More affordable than Mindbody with similar core functionality for boutique studios
- Automated billing handles retries, pauses, and failed payments without manual work
- Modern API allows custom integrations for studios with developer resources
Cons
- No consumer marketplace — you lose Mindbody-style discovery of new clients
- Pricing requires contacting sales — no transparent pricing page
- Integration library is smaller than Mindbody — some niche tools may not connect
- Reporting depth is limited for multi-location operators needing complex analytics
- Newer platform means some edge cases and features are still being developed
